Auto Body Repairer

Course Description

This apprenticeship program provides Auto Body Repairer apprentices with an understanding of the ever-changing automotive technology field. In addition, apprentices gain the technical skills required to use state-of-the-art equipment to properly and profitably repair damaged vehicles. Apprentices attend three 8-week levels of 30 hours per week of in-class sessions. Sixty per cent of class time is spent in theory and 40 per cent learning practical, hands-on skills. In the basic, intermediate, and advanced levels, apprentices learn the different types of body construction, repair techniques and refinishing procedures.

Career outcomes

Graduates may be employed as apprentice/journey-person auto body technicians. Opportunities exist in independent collision and auto body repair facilities, automobile dealerships, government, vehicle salvage facilities and insurance companies.
